The offensive line is composed of the 7 offensive linemen that have to be on the line of scrimage at the start of a play. Their job is to block the defense in order to prevent them from tackling the player with the ball. Out of the 7 linemen on the O-line there are 4 types. There is center, guard, tackle, and end. The center is the lineman that snaps the ball to the quarterback. The guard lines on either side of the center. The tackle lines up outside of the guard. The end can either be wide or tight. If the end is tight he will line up just outside of the tackle. If the end is wide he will line up closer to the sideline, like a wide reciever, but on the line of scrimmage.
